Kolkata: The death of Australian batsman Philip Hughes may have reignited the debate of safety in cricket, but former India captain Nari Contractor, one of the first cricketers to fall to a bouncer, is not in favour of a "knee jerk reaction".

"It is a very tragic. Some people are calling for change in rules and do away with bouncers. If that is done, it will take away the beauty of Test cricket," Contractor told IANS over the phone.
